Advantages of Each Platform
In the trading world, being able to say you know the difference between MT4 and MT5 is like knowing when to buy Tesla before Elon Musk tweets. So let's put those differences under the microscope. MT4, launched (it seems like eons ago) in 2005, is ideal for forex traders who prefer to handle a simple system, free from the complications of unnecessary options.
On the other hand, MT5, the older brother, brings an arsenal of new and improved features. Essential for those aspiring to diversify their portfolio beyond the conventional. Let's see the spectacular advantages of each one.
MT4: The Classic
Simplicity of use: MT4 is the logic of simple things that work. With a user-friendly interface, even my dog (metaphorically) could learn to trade.
Professional tools: Without exaggerating, MT4 offers a solid range of charting tools and technical indicators, enough to impress any veteran trader.
Solid community: With years in the market, the online community supporting MT4 is like having Google at your fingertips. You can find solutions for almost any problem.
MT5: The Young
Variety of markets: MT5 is not just suitable for forex; it opens the doors to CFDs, stocks, and futures, just like an all-you-can-eat buffet.
Advanced features: It offers more pending orders and analysis tools. Like having a mediator always ready with steaming coffee.
Enhanced backtesting: Faster simulations and an extensive price history. A true play of lights and shadows in the hands of a trader.
Finally, the verdict on which platform is better may depend as much on your experience as on your trading aspirations. For those only seeking forex and simplicity, MT4 is the reliable friend. For those who want an investment sky full of stars, MT5 is the spaceship you should consider.
